## Provenance: Formula Sandbox

All user-supplied formulas in Quillbasin run inside the Hermit sandbox, which is built and signed by our provenance pipeline. Support should never trust a sandbox image without a verified attestation. When escalating, always quote the exact build identifier, which appears directly below.

build token for kagaf-hahof: htk14_9d3d4d26d7d8de

Quick note for the sync: the GreenLoft controller's humidity sensors drift about 2% per week, so the /calibrate endpoint now accepts a baseline_offset param. Call it nightly via the Sproutline scheduler and the drift compensation kicks in automatically. Readings older than 48 hours get flagged stale and excluded from averaging. Calls to the calibration service must authenticate against our internal Sproutline gateway using the key below.

app token of bawep-hafog = kto7_vwrmnlx

### Step 4 — Deploy the reconnect fix (Murkwater relay)

The fix caps exponential backoff at 30s and adds jitter, so review `reconnect.ts` for the new WS_BACKOFF_CAP_MS and WS_JITTER_PCT vars. Both default sanely; override only on the Tallowgate staging relay. Confirm the client no longer hammers the relay after a broker restart — check for the absence of `RECONNECT_STORM` log lines. The relay now requires authenticated reconnect handshakes, so the token must be present in the env file. Append this line before restarting:

secret setting of fawep-tagaf: ARCHIVE_KEY3=ce5